A strong CIBIL score is essential when applying for home or personal loans. Lenders heavily rely on it to assess your creditworthiness and decide interest rates. In 2025, maintaining a score of 700+ opens doors to competitive loan offers, while anything above 750 earns premium terms. Here’s your guide to building and maintaining a robust credit score. 1. Understand Your CIBIL Score & Why It Matters Your CIBIL score is a three-digit number (300–900) that reflects your repayment history, outstanding debts, credit mix, and past inquiries. It directly impacts your ability to secure loans and premium interest rates. Regular monitoring…
